XEL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

628 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Xcel Energy (XEL)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$14.6B — up 1% from $14.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 95 funds opened new XEL positions and 46 closed out — a net gain of 49 holders — while 216 added to existing stakes and 202 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Massachusetts Financial Services, adding an estimated $99.3M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$111M.
